One more considerable location of emphasis for the Chinese robotics field is the raising execution of collaborative robots, often referred to as cobots. These robots are designed to work alongside human operators in a shared work area, carrying out a series of tasks from material dealing with to assembly support. The application of cobots represents a shift in how businesses in China perceive robot modern technology; instead than watching robots as a substitute for human labor, companies are beginning to harness them as partners that can boost and increase human abilities security. The rise of cobots in China can be credited to their ability to streamline intricate jobs, making it possible for business to make best use of labor force effectiveness without the requirement for extensive re-training or workflow redesign.

A significant metric that highlights the change in China's robotics ability is the robot density in the country's manufacturing fields. Robot density refers to the variety of robots per 10,000 employees in a certain industry. According to current stats, China has actually made considerable progression in enhancing its robot density, leading the globe in terms of overall industrial robot installations. This boost plays a crucial role in keeping the balance between labor demands and technological improvement, making certain that China continues to be a famous manufacturing hub on a worldwide range. As the world's largest market for industrial robots, China's development trajectory signals both a feedback to domestic labor lacks and an aggressive approach to improving performance through automation.
